titleOfInvention |
Fuel cell separator and method for producing the same |
abstract |
PROBLEM TO BE SOLVED: To provide a separator for a fuel cell in which the skin layer is removed, the contact resistance between an electrode gas diffusion layer and an adjacent separator is reduced, and the increase in surface hydrophobicity is prevented, and a method for producing the same. [Solution] A step of molding a resin composition containing a resin and a conductive material, and a blasting process using an abrasive in which abrasive grains are dispersed in a base material of an elastic body, to remove a skin layer formed on the surface A separator for a fuel cell having a surface roughness after removing the skin layer, the arithmetic average roughness Ra being 0.2 to 0.8 μm, and the maximum height Rz being 1.0 to 4.0 μm Method.
